What makes your Red Velvet cake red? ( I am from the UK I haven't seen it over here ) is it just a food colouring? I think that cake looks fantastic!
 
What makes your Red Velvet cake red? ( I am from the UK I haven't seen it over here ) is it just a food colouring? I think that cake looks fantastic!

The flavor of red velvet is a white cake with a small amount of cocoa in it, and the red is from food coloring. It always has a cream cheese frosting.
